About Wenzhi Chen

Wenzhi Chen is a scholar working on Obstetrics and Gynecology, Reproductive Medicine and Dermatology, having authored 15 papers that have together received 806 indexed citations. Recurring topics across this work include Uterine Myomas and Treatments (10 papers), Endometriosis Research and Treatment (9 papers) and Gynecological conditions and treatments (6 papers). The work is most often cited by research in Obstetrics and Gynecology (384 citations), Reproductive Medicine (315 citations) and Radiology, Nuclear Medicine and Imaging (199 citations). Wenzhi Chen has collaborated with scholars based in China, Italy and United States. Frequent co-authors include Zhibiao Wang, Lian Zhang, Hui Zhu, Zhilong Wang, Feng Wu, Jin Bai, Jianzhong Zou, Song Peng, Jinyun Chen and Kequan Li. Their work appears in journals such as Ultrasonics Sonochemistry, Ultrasound in Medicine & Biology and European Journal of Radiology.
